Area Roundup
Colleen Lawler scored 17 points off the bench and new starting guard Dani Fine had 16 points, five assists and four rebounds Wednesday as Community Colleges of Spokane broke a two-game conference losing streak with a 72-65 win over Big Bend at Moses Lake.
CCS (8-8, 1-2 NWAACC) also got 10 points off the bench from Jaclyn Humphrey.

Prep wrestling
Pins in the first two matches started University toward a 44-18 Greater Spokane League wrestling dual win over visiting Ferris.
Trailing 19-14, Tim Buchanan of U-Hi pinned Ty Williams in the last second in the 190-pound match. U-Hi’s Jeff Schmedding (215) followed with a third-round pin of Jeremy Morton.
Chris Cluver (275) of Ferris won an entertaining 21-20 match over Jeff Hollenbach, then the Titans broke loose with five consecutive wins. Gordon Bash (101), Jared Osborn (115) and Sam Butler (158) had U-Hi’s other pins. Eric Simmons (168) had Ferris’ lone pin. U-Hi (4-1) remained in third place and closed ground on Gonzaga Prep (5-0) and Central Valley (4-0), who wrestle tonight. Sixth-place Ferris is 2-4.
